      Let us look at some other common percentage amounts, and their fraction and decimal equiva-lents. 75% = 75 100 = 3 4 = 0.75 50% = 50 100 = 1 2 = 0.5 25% = 25 100 = 1 4 = 0.25 10% = 10 100 = 1 10 = 0.1 5% = 5 100 = 1 20 = 0.05. It is worth noting that 50% can be found be dividing by 2, and that 10% is easily found by dividing by 10. Now let us ...

      Adapted from Dansmath.com Quick Guide to Percentages and Decimals The % is a percent sign, meaning divided by 100. So 25% means 25/100, or 1/4. To convert a percentage to a decimal, divide by 100. So 25% is 25/100, or 0.25. To convert a decimal to a percentage, multiply by 100 (just move the decimal point 2 places to the right).
